Output 862baf9869ab3d71a07cc2ffd109ba5d7dfba066ecfb10ba55d7757138027c89:1

value
812116
script pubkey
OP_0 OP_PUSHBYTES_32 315ea9a5870f8f9ab9578534813749bf1e562f9fbf63e9e1bc8562be254a4c54
address
bc1qx902nfv8p78e4w2hs56gzd6fhu09vtulha37ncdus43tuf22f32qz3ucq9
transaction
862baf9869ab3d71a07cc2ffd109ba5d7dfba066ecfb10ba55d7757138027c89
confirmations
224339
spent
true